Putin decorates Serb WW2 veterans

Putin decorates Serb WW2 veterans

BELGRADE -- Serbia's WW2 veterans have been decorated with the jubilee medals of the Russian Federation on the occasion of 70 years of victory over fascism.

The medals have been presented by Russian Ambassador to Serbia Aleksandr Chepurin in the name of Russian President Vladimir Putin.

Defence Ministry: Manifestations dedicated to Year of War Veterans in all large garrisons in country

The Ministry of National Defence (MApN) is organizing this year in all the large garrisons in the country special manifestations dedicated to the Year of War Veterans, 70 years after the end of the Second World War, MApN informs.

Jean-Marc Todeschini: It is important the young know their history to make their own opinion

Visiting French Secretary of state for War Veterans and Memory, Jean-Marc Todeschini said on Thursday night that it is important for the young to know their history, thus being capable to make their own opinion upon the events, and voiced appreciation for the Romanian Government's initiative to declare 2015 the "Year of the War Veterans."
